The demand for inclusive tech talent has surged as companies commit to measurable DEI outcomes. With over 2,100 open positions, roles that blend technical acumen with human‑centric strategy are now central to product and workforce innovation.

Positions range from DEI Analysts using Power BI and Workday to Senior Inclusion Architects designing inclusive product roadmaps. Responsibilities include auditing bias in algorithms, crafting equity dashboards, partnering with engineering to embed inclusive design, and leading cross‑functional workshops.

Salary transparency is vital for DEI professionals because it reveals equity gaps, empowers negotiations, and signals an organization’s genuine commitment to fairness—critical for attracting and retaining diverse talent.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ority for DEI roles?
Entry‑level DEI Analysts earn $60k–$80k; mid‑level positions range $80k–$110k; senior specialists and managers command $110k–$150k; directors and VP roles reach $150k–$200k plus bonuses.
What skills and certifications are required?
Core skills include data analysis, HRIS (Workday, BambooHR), people analytics, project management, and communication. Certifications such as SHRM‑CP/SCP, CDEI, and Cornell DEI Certificate boost credibility.
Is remote work common in these roles?
Yes—most DEI positions offer full‑remote or hybrid arrangements, especially in SaaS, fintech, and cloud‑service companies that prioritize flexible work cultures.
What career progression paths exist?
Typical paths move from DEI Analyst → DEI Manager → Inclusion Lead → Director of DEI → VP of Inclusion, with opportunities to transition into product or HR leadership.
What industry trends are shaping DEI careers?
Emerging trends include AI‑driven bias detection, intersectionality frameworks, regulatory reporting mandates, and increased DEI budget allocations, all driving demand for data‑savvy inclusion experts.
